Computing Contour Trees for 2D Piecewise Polynomial Functions
نویسندگان
چکیده
Contour trees are extensively used in scalar field analysis. The contour tree is a data structure that tracks the evolution of level set topology in a scalar field. Scalar fields are typically available as samples at vertices of a mesh and are linearly interpolated within each cell of the mesh. A more suitable way of representing scalar fields, especially when a smoother function needs to be modeled, is via higher order interpolants. We propose an algorithm to compute the contour tree for such functions. The algorithm computes a local structure by connecting critical points using a numerically stable monotone path tracing procedure. Such structures are computed for each cell and are stitched together to obtain the contour tree of the function. The algorithm is scalable to higher degree interpolants whereas previous methods were restricted to quadratic or linear interpolants. The algorithm is intrinsically parallelizable and has potential applications to isosurface extraction.
منابع مشابه
gH-differentiable of the 2th-order functions interpolating
Fuzzy Hermite interpolation of 5th degree generalizes Lagrange interpolation by fitting a polynomial to a function f that not only interpolates f at each knot but also interpolates two number of consecutive Generalized Hukuhara derivatives of f at each knot. The provided solution for the 5th degree fuzzy Hermite interpolation problem in this paper is based on cardinal basis functions linear com...
متن کاملAdaptive multiresolution analysis based on anisotropic triangulations
A simple greedy refinement procedure for the generation of data-adapted triangulations is proposed and studied. Given a function f of two variables, the algorithm produces a hierarchy of triangulations (Dj)j≥0 and piecewise polynomial approximations of f on these triangulations. The refinement procedure consists in bisecting a triangle T in a direction which is chosen so as to minimize the loca...
متن کاملThe Piecewise Polynomial Partition of Unity Functions for the Generalized Finite Element Methods
Abstract A partition of unity (PU) function is an essential component of the generalized finite element method (GFEM). The popular Shepard PU functions, which are rational functions, are easy to construct, but have difficulties in dealing with essential boundary conditions and require lengthy computing time for reasonable accuracy in numerical integration. In this paper, we introduce two simple...
متن کاملThe generalized product partition of unity for the meshless methods
The partition of unity is an essential ingredient for meshless methods named by GFEM, PUFEM (partition of unity FEM), XFEM(extended FEM), RKPM(reproducing kernel particle method), RPPM(reproducing polynomial particle method), the method of clouds in the literature. There are two popular choices for partition of unity: a piecewise linear FEM mesh and the Shepard-type partition of unity. However,...
متن کاملThe Shape of an Image - A Study of Mapper on Images
We study the topological construction called Mapper in the context of simply connected domains, in particular on images. The Mapper construction can be considered as a generalization for contour, split, and joint trees on simply connected domains. A contour tree on an image domain assumes the height function to be a piecewise linear Morse function. This is a rather restrictive class of function...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ید
ثبت ناماگ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ید
ورودعنوان ژورنال:
- Comput. Graph. Forum
دوره 36 شماره
صفحات -
تاریخ انتشار 2017